> (0) The func must be declared as delegate (instead of simple func pointer)
> because: the actual func hex beeing defined in a block, the compiler turns it
> into a delegate. Detail.
See also:
void foo(In, Out)(Out function(In) f) {}
void main() {
static int bar(int i) { return 0; }
foo(&bar);
}
